Oga Obinna Sounds Alarm Over Stoopid Boy's Suicide Threat Following Family Crisis - March 2026

Kenyan media personality Oga Obinna has raised an alarm for rapper Stoopid Boy, who posted a concerning video detailing his intention to commit suicide. The incident comes amid growing concerns about mental health crises among young people in Kenya. At the same time, Pastor Victor Kanyari of the Salvation Healing Ministry has expressed frustration over social media personality Marion Naipei's ongoing struggle with alcoholism, even after being ordained for church duties. Both cases highlight the struggles of young people in the entertainment industry facing personal challenges. Additionally, Akothee has clarified her relationship with Raymond Omollo, the Principal Secretary for Interior and National Administration, revealing he is her uncle, while Lilian Ng'ang'a has ignited an online discussion by challenging the common belief that men do not love their children, asserting that paternal absence doesn't necessarily signify a lack of love. Separately, Mugithi musician Samidoh Muchoki has announced his intention to vie for the Member of Parliament seat in Ol Joro Orok Constituency during the 2027 General Election, marking another entertainer's entry into politics.

Samidoh declares his entry into politics, to vie for Ol Joro Orok MP seat

Samidoh declares his entry into politics, to vie for Ol Joro Orok MP seat

Mugithi musician Samidoh Muchoki has announced his intention to vie for the Member of Parliament seat in Ol Joro Orok Constituency during the 2027 General Election.

  • He plans to run under the Democracy for the Citizens Party (DCP), a party linked to former Deputy President Rigathi Gachagua.
  • The constituency is located in Nyandarua County and has an estimated population of over 90,000 residents.
  • This move follows subtle social media hints and a voter registration drive using the hashtag "#TukoKadi", signaling early political mobilisation efforts.
